After a summer of overcrowding and understaffing in the Enchantments, day-use management has reached a critical moment. Join Seattle Times outdoors reporter Gregory Scruggs, TREAD Executive Director Mat Lyons, and Wenatchee Outdoors Executive Director Sarah Shaffer for a discussion on potential changes along the Icicle Creek corridor, lessons from other mountain towns, and on-the-ground stewardship efforts in the Enchantments.
This hybrid event offers both in-person and online viewing. Watch live or later on YouTube via the link on WRI’s calendar—no registration required. RSVP to receive reminders and updates. Doors open at 6:30pm for a community social with beer and wine available for purchase; the presentation begins at 7:00pm.

Interactive glassblowing experience at Boulder Bend Glassworks.
During this workshop you’ll have the opportunity to choose and create your own unique glass piece(s) under the guidance of Craig or Jori. Each participant will enjoy a hands-on experience in the hot shop, witnessing the transformation of molten glass into a stunning work of art.
Book multiple sessions and bring friends or family to share in the fun of glassblowing. We offer this interactive experience most Saturdays, with approximately 60-90 minute sessions for 1-2 participants available throughout the day. The project choices will change every few months with the holidays and seasons. Minimum age 14.

Design your own glass fusing in a variety of shapes using colorful hand-pulled cane and murrine made at our studio. No plate glass used here!
Come to the Boulder Bend Glassworks studio and start your fusing workshop anytime between 10 am to 3 pm. No reservations required. Generally, participants take 40 to 90 minutes to design their glass piece.
Available for ages 7 and up. Participants under 18 require a parent or guardian.
For groups of 6 or more, please inquire regarding a private workshop.
